From the Redwood Forest

We're new members ... recent retirees in Northern California's Redwood Forest ... Humboldt County ... yeah, that other stuff grows here too. We live on 18ac near Fortuna, CA. I'm a certified massage therapist. My wife plays accordion.

We pulled (06 Dodge dually) our Northwood Nash 27TT to the Grand Canyon last October and then made a cross-country run (8K miles) to Juno Beach, FL this February. Boy, the I-10 will kick your butt in parts of TX and LA but we had no major problems. Ate some 'gator, heard some music, saw the Gulf Coast trying to make a comeback from storm damage, bad economy, and greasy beaches. They're trying hard but the "for sale" signs are more plentiful than tourists.

We're planning on making the run to Fairbanks via Alaska Highway in summer '13. We're doing the research and always interested in advice.
